1. Wild West Sunset Horseback Ride with Dinner from Las Vegas

Wild West Sunset Horseback Ride With Dinner From Las Vegas

Riding into the sunset on horseback is a classic Western fantasy, and this Wild West Sunset Horseback Ride delivers it with style. Led by a professional wrangler, you’ll traverse the Nevada desert, searching for wildlife like bighorn sheep, jackrabbits, and roadrunners. The ride lasts about 2 hours and culminates in a barbecue dinner around a campfire under the stars. Round-trip transportation from Las Vegas hotels makes it easy to enjoy without the hassle of driving.

This tour stands out for its authentic cowboy atmosphere, with reviews praising the helpful guides and the relaxed pace that makes it accessible for most riders. The highlight is ending your evening around the campfire, where stories and singing are optional but encouraged. At $159.99, it offers a unique blend of outdoor adventure and hearty food, perfect for families or couples craving a Western experience.

3. Tournament of Kings Dinner and Show at Excalibur Hotel and Casino

Tournament of Kings Dinner and Show at Excalibur Hotel and Casino

At number 3, the Tournament of Kings combines a lively medieval jousting show with a hearty feast of roasted chicken, vegetables, and bread. This immersive dinner show lasts about 1.5 hours and transports you into a time of kings, knights, and dragons. The interactive element gets everyone involved—cheering on your designated “country” and participating in the medieval festivities.

The show is perfect for families, with lively action and a fun atmosphere that appeals to kids and adults alike. The pricing is attractive at $78.29, with some discounts available through June 2025. Reviewers mention it’s a “must-see” for those looking for entertainment that’s both engaging and delicious.

5. “31 String Showdown” Show & Dinner at Firelight Barn in Henderson

Chuck Wagon Dinner and Show at the Firelight Barn in Henderson

A family-friendly choice, the “31 String Showdown” combines live music, clogging, and Western entertainment with a mouthwatering barbecue meal. Held at the Firelight Barn, the show features the Jackson Family Band & Mama’s Wranglers, playing everything from Western classics to Doo Wop. The experience lasts about 2 hours and is perfect for those wanting a true Western experience outside the Strip.

With a perfect rating of 5.0, reviews praise the talent, food, and friendly atmosphere. The ticket price of $49 is very competitive for this all-ages event, making it ideal for families or travelers seeking a relaxed, fun evening.

9. BLACKOUT Dining in the Dark Experience, Dining Attraction

BLACKOUT Dining in the Dark Experience, Dining Attraction

If you’re after something truly different, the Blackout experience in Vegas is a dining adventure where you eat in total darkness. The multi-course, plant-based meal is designed to heighten your senses of taste and smell—a surreal experience. It lasts about 1 hour 30 minutes and costs $95.

Reviews highlight the unique environment and phenomenal food. Many say it’s “hands down the most awesome thing I’ve ever done,” and it’s especially good for foodies looking for a sensory challenge.

15. Lake Mead: Sunset Kayaking Tour with Dinner and Campfire

Lake Mead: Sunset Kayaking Tour with Dinner and Campfire

Ending our list is a sunset kayak tour on Lake Mead, combined with dinner and a campfire. You’ll paddle among the Boulder Islands, watch the desert sunset, and enjoy roasting s’mores. The tour lasts about 3 hours, with all equipment included.

Rated 5.0, this experience is perfect for active travelers who want an outdoor adventure combined with relaxation. Guests rave about the peaceful scenery and stunning sunset views.
